Neuware - BUILD BETTER WORLDS-TOGETHER!- A game-changing TTRPG guide to collaborative storytelling and campaign creation- Written by Jonah Fishel and Tristan Fishel, bestselling creators of The Game Master's Handbook of Proactive Roleplaying- Perfect for Dungeon Masters who want deeper, more meaningful storytellingThe Game Master's Handbook of Collaborative Campaign Design redefines what it means to run a Dungeons & Dragons campaign. Instead of relying on stat blocks or pre-written modules, this essential roleplaying guide teaches Game Masters how to co-create immersive stories with their players-building worlds, character arcs, and emotional payoffs that everyone invests in.Inside, you'll find step-by-step methods for planning, writing, and running collaborative campaigns that adapt to your players' ideas in real time. Learn how to build narrative arcs that evolve organically, write satisfying endings, and design encounters that fit your world's tone and themes.With detailed case studies, ready-to-use templates, and 'Session 1' collaboration exercises, this tabletop RPG handbook helps you master the art of shared storytelling. Whether you're running D&D 5e, Pathfinder, or a homebrew RPG, this is the ultimate toolkit for crafting adventures your players will remember for years.
